Veteran actress Saira Banu shared a social media post on Monday evening updating her husband, ailing Bollywood legend Dilip Kumar's health. She took to thespian's Twitter account and assured netizens that he is well and will be discharged soon.
Her statement reads: "Past few days my beloved husband, Yousuf Khan, has been unwell and recuperating at a hospital in Mumbai. Through this note, I want to thank all of you for keeping him in your prayers and for all the love and affection. My husband, my Kohinoor our Dilip Kumar Sahab's health is stable and doctors have assured me that he should be discharged soon."
Requesting netizens to not pay heed to rumours, the actress further wrote: "I urge you not to believe in rumours. While I ask you to pray for Sahab's health, I am praying that the almighty keep all of you safe and healthy during this pandemic."
Dilip Kumar was admitted to Mumbai's Hinduja hospital on Sunday after complaining of breathlessness. Around Monday noon, a twitter post on his official handle said the actor was on oxygen support and not on ventilator.
In a separate Tweet, media personnel were requested not to pay heed to rumours of actor's death and only share verified news with actor's fans.
